Clinical Utility of Body Weight Monitoring During Cisplatin-based Chemotherapy
Naoki Odaira1,2, Masaki Yoshino3, Koki Yamashita4
1Department of Pharmacy, Niigata Cancer Center Hospital, Niigata, Japan.
Weight monitoring effectively tracks fluid balance in patients receiving cisplatin chemotherapy, reducing healthcare worker exposure to anticancer drugs. This method offers a practical alternative to urine output monitoring for assessing acute kidney injury risk.
Area of Science:
- Nephrology
- Oncology
- Pharmacology
Background:
- Cisplatin (CDDP) chemotherapy can cause acute kidney injury (AKI), with urine output being a key clinical indicator.
- Urine collection poses exposure risks for healthcare workers to cytotoxic anticancer drugs.
- Weight-based fluid balance assessment is a potential alternative for monitoring CDDP-induced AKI.
Purpose of the Study:
- To evaluate water intake, urine output, and body weight changes in patients undergoing CDDP chemotherapy.
- To determine the utility of weight monitoring as a practical indicator of fluid balance during CDDP-based chemotherapy.
- To assess the correlation between water balance and body weight changes.
Main Methods:
- A cohort of 15 patients receiving CDDP-vinorelbine chemotherapy for non-small cell lung cancer was studied.
- Patients self-recorded oral fluid intake.
- Body weight changes were measured on days 2-4 relative to a baseline on day 1.
Main Results:
- No instances of CDDP-induced AKI were observed.
- Urine output initially decreased but recovered by day 3; body weight peaked on day 3 (+3.6 kg) and began decreasing on day 4.
- A significant positive correlation (r=0.68) was found between water balance and next-morning weight change.
Conclusions:
- Weight monitoring serves as a practical indicator of fluid balance during CDDP chemotherapy.
- This method may decrease healthcare worker exposure to anticancer agents.
- Weight monitoring is a viable alternative to urine output for assessing fluid status and AKI risk.
